Product Description

A heart-warming family drama spanning three generations, with an unforgettable love story at its heart.When the telegram arrives on a bright sunny day in 1942, Nancy feels sick with dread. But instead of wartime bad news it's from the legendary Jackie Cochran, asking Nancy to fly for Great Britain. For Nancy, a girl with flying in her blood, it's an opportunity she simply can't turn down. But that fateful decision is to trigger a series of events, with consequences that will reverberate through the generations. In summer 2006, Sarah is at a crossroads in her life when her adored grandmother Nancy asks her to help lay the ghosts of her past to rest. Sarah agrees, little suspecting the long-buried and shocking secrets that will be dragged to the surface.From the tension of World War Two right up to the present day, this is a sweeping family story that is both moving and unforgettable.

I took this book with me to read on holiday and couldn't put it down. I just wanted to read more and more from the very first page.

You are immediately drawn into the present lives of the main characters, who span three generations, feeling with each their hopes, dreams and problems, in their very different and fascinating worlds. And yet, although they are all so different, there is something about each one you can personally relate to. Linking them all is Grandma Nancy, an old lady, looking back over her life, reliving its highs and lows and secrets, pondering its outcome, and wishing to right its wrongs. And as more and more of her past life emerges, so each of her family find themselves facing again their own pasts, and coming to terms with the buried thoughts, feelings and misunderstandings that link them, and that have led them to where they now are.

On one level, this is a lovely story of a remembered life and love in wartime, but more than that, it is an amazing exploration of the complexities of real life personalities and relationships that shape lives. Each character is superficially very different, but black and white soon turns to shades of grey as you see each one, not just as they appear to be, but also through their own hidden thoughts and feelings. And as you understand more and more of each, they become ever increasingly real and interesting, and you cant wait to learn more.

This is a very well told page turner. A lovely story that encompasses all the dilemmas and complexities of life, with an unexpected ending that keeps you guessing right to the end. Just brilliant !! You must read it.

`Dance With Wings' continuously and seamlessly moves from past to present gradually revealing how events that unfold and choices that are made by the central character during the 2nd world war impact on their families over the next two generations.
Masterfully narrated through 5 very different characters the story reflects the life changing decisions that reverberate through the years. Secrets that are kept, misconceptions drawn, passions set aside, loyalties unselfishly sustained and love that remains undiminished through the passage of time.
As a group of teachers from a variety of backgrounds cultures and ages, our book club all found parallels drawn from our own lives and the lives of relatives and friends - many of whom were still living with the `consequences' of just such secrets kept hidden within families. We loved the clever weaving from past to present and how each character revealed a new dimension to the widening story; dealing in very different ways with the cards they were dealt.
This book is a real page turner and a great one to curl up with on a blustery afternoon.

This is a wonderful book about a family saga through the generations. Told by various key characters within the book, the story comes to life through their thoughts, actions and memories.

I particularly like reading about the 2WW period, so this book also gave me further insight into what it was like for pilots in training before going off to war.

The biggest suprise though was that I thought I knew how it was all going to end....it kept me on the edge of my seat and then had a suprisingly different end to what I'd imagined! Brilliant!

I read it in just 3 days and I would recommend this as a great summer read, on the beach or under that sun umbrella! You'll find you really want to know what the 'secret' is, you'll probably shed a small tear, but without a doubt you'll be gripped and be anxious to find out how it all ends!
